Understanding Loan Percentage Calculators

A loan percentage calculator is a financial tool that helps prospective borrowers estimate the total cost of a loan based on its principal, interest rate, and term length. With a simple input of these factors, you can gain insights into monthly payments, total payable interest, and the entire financial burden over the life of the loan.

Key Terminology

  1. Principal: The original amount borrowed.
  2. Interest Rate: The cost of borrowing money, expressed as a percentage.
  3. Loan Term: The duration over which you agree to repay the loan.
  4. Monthly Payment: The fixed amount due each month.
  5. Amortization: The process of paying off a debt over time through scheduled payments.

Common Drawbacks

Despite their benefits, loan percentage calculators aren’t without limitations:

  1. Variability in Rates: The calculator relies on the accuracy of the inputted interest rates, which may vary from lender to lender.
  2. Additional Costs: Calculators often don’t account for fees, insurance, or taxes which can impact the total cost of the loan.
  3. Generic Information: Many calculators provide a one-size-fits-all approach and may not cater to specific financial situations.
